RSVP GCPE Book Talk, Sep 29: Disrupting D.C.: The Rise of Uber and the Fall of the City  
September 29
Book Talk - Disrupting D.C.: The Rise of Uber and the Fall of the City, Princeton University Press, 2023
5:30pm, ENG 307, Pratt Brooklyn campus
Free & open to the public, RSVP required
Book talk with the Authors (Katie J. Wells, Kafui Attoh, Declan Cullen). A panoramic account of the urban politics and deep social divisions that gave rise to Uber and what's needed in contemporary struggles for the right to the city. Presented by the GCPE Urban and Community Planning program and SAVI.
